Avoid All Legal Hassles Hire A No Win No Fee Solicitor As Soon As Possible

When you endure a personal injury and suffer damages because of someone else’s fault, you are legally permitted to file a compensation claim. You can claim for compensation if you have been the victim of someone’s reckless activity at road, at your workplace or even at some public place. If you have suffered any of the above, file for a claim with the help of a no win no fee solicitor.
Although there is no legal binding that the plaintiff should have a personal injury lawyer to fight his case, yet, it is always advisable that you take the aid of an attorney to file your claim. These expert attorneys have the skills and experience needed to file a claim and they make sure that your legal rights are protected and you get the right compensation.
Remember that even a minor accident can cause grave injuries and the damages which might look minor may become very severe later. And hence it is all the more important to consult an attorney so that you exactly know your status and the compensation you can claim for. It is also advisable to employ an expert personal injury lawyer as soon as possible.

... numerous advantages of hiring a personal injury lawyer as early as possible if you have been injured. They not only guide you and collect evidence for you, but also take you through entire process, thus making the entire process very hassle free. Remember that no sooner you file a claim, than the insurance companies will start their investigations. If you have a legal representative, he will handle those questions for you, thus reducing the pressure off you. The solicitors also ensure that you don’t reveal certain details to the insurance company or the police which might weaken your case. Insurance companies want to save costs and hence they might coerce the plaintiff for a settlement. And if you don’t have a solicitor, you may be influenced to settle your claim for less than it is actually worth.
And you don’t have to avert yourself from hiring a lawyer, thinking about the heavy fees you might have to pay to your attorney. With the advent of contingent fee agreement; you don’t have to bother about the additional finances involved to file a claim. You don’t have to pay anything to your lawyer if he loses the case. However, if he wins the claim for you, his finances are recovered from the other party or their insurance company.
Whether to take the assistance of an expert attorney or not, is your decision. Still, if the liability is disputed and uncertain or there were staid injuries or fiscal losses, then it is by and large advantageous to seek the advice of a qualified attorney as soon after the accident as possible.
